Output 75f6d5a334a1924b447028fd7937a8e0d1efaeff990c4a628b480d11b129b254:17

value
15911800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c51e14e08e635eb84f844527b06dcbd0816347f OP_EQUAL
address
AB4cbemeam7xVQt6t8TRA2oLTsg4MA5j8U
transaction
75f6d5a334a1924b447028fd7937a8e0d1efaeff990c4a628b480d11b129b254